Calibrating the pressure sensor
The pressure sensor is calibrated at the factory by BUCHI prior to delivery. However, it
can be recalibrated with the aid of an external reference pressure gauge at any time.

Press the Menu button and select Pressure sensor calibration.

Offset calibration
An offset has to be specified if the pressure indicated on the interface unit differs from
the pressure indicated by an external reference pressure gauge. The difference be
tween the two figures is referred to as the offset. The offset applies to the entire pres
sure range.

On the calibration menu, select the option Calibration pressure offset.

Using the arrow buttons, set the offset and press OK to confirm.
The measured readings will then automatically be adjusted by the specified offset.

Make sure that the reference pressure indicated on the interface unit matches the
figure shown on the external reference pressure gauge.
